What Makes Lightning Roulette Stand Out

Lightning Roulette keeps the core of European roulette – a single zero wheel, a live dealer, and crisp HD streaming – but adds a layer of excitement that traditional tables simply cannot match. Each round features a “Lightning” phase where the software selects between one and five numbers and attaches a random multiplier ranging from 10× to 500×. When your chip lands on a highlighted number, the multiplier is applied to your win, turning a standard 35:1 payout into something far more lucrative.

The appeal lies in the marriage of two worlds: roulette purists still enjoy the strategic placement of bets, while slot enthusiasts are drawn to the sudden, high‑risk, high‑reward bursts that feel like a jackpot spin. This duality expands the player base, attracting those who might otherwise avoid table games because they seem too predictable.

The Lightning Multipliers Explained

Before each spin the engine randomly chooses up to five numbers and assigns multipliers of 10×, 25×, 50×, 100× or 500×. The selected numbers are displayed on the virtual wheel and highlighted on the dealer’s board, giving everyone a clear visual cue. If your bet lands on one of these numbers, the multiplier is applied on top of the usual roulette payout, dramatically increasing the potential return.

How Live‑Casino Technology Elevates the Table‑Game Experience

Modern live‑dealer studios use multiple 4K cameras, low‑latency streaming codecs, and dedicated fiber connections to deliver a seamless view of the wheel from every angle. You can switch between a wide‑angle shot of the entire table, a close‑up of the dealer’s hand, and a focused view of the betting layout, ensuring you never miss a multiplier highlight.

Behind the scenes, an independent RNG governs the selection of Lightning numbers and their multipliers, while the dealer’s actions remain genuine. This hybrid approach preserves the authenticity of a live dealer while guaranteeing that the multiplier outcomes are provably fair.

Mobile optimisation means the same high‑definition feed runs smoothly on iOS and Android devices. Touch‑screen betting pads let you place chips with a tap, and the interface automatically updates to show which numbers are currently “lit.” Whether you’re on a commuter train or lounging on a couch, the experience mirrors the desktop version without sacrificing speed or clarity.

The Mechanics Behind Lightning Multipliers

The algorithm that powers Lightning multipliers runs a two‑step process. First, it draws a random integer between 1 and 5 to decide how many numbers will receive a multiplier in the upcoming spin. Second, it selects those numbers from the 37‑slot European wheel and assigns each a multiplier drawn from a weighted pool (10× appears most often, while 500× is the rarest). Because the selection is independent of the wheel spin, the probability of any single number being highlighted is roughly 5/37 ≈ 13.5 % at maximum, but the actual chance varies with the number of multipliers chosen that round.

Despite the eye‑popping payouts, the overall odds remain fair. The expected value (EV) of a straight‑up bet with Lightning is calculated by combining the standard 35:1 payout with the probability‑weighted multiplier outcomes. In practice, the EV is slightly lower than a pure European roulette bet because the multipliers are applied only to the small subset of highlighted numbers, while the rest of the wheel behaves normally. This balance ensures the house edge stays close to the classic 2.7 % figure, preserving long‑term sustainability.

Risk Management in a High‑Variance Game

Because multipliers are rare, bankroll discipline is essential. Many players allocate a small percentage (1‑2 %) of their total bankroll to each Lightning spin, allowing them to survive the inevitable losing streaks while still being positioned to capitalize on a big hit. Setting loss limits and sticking to them prevents the excitement from turning into costly impulsivity.

Beginner‑Friendly Betting Strategies

  • Flat betting – wager the same amount on each spin, typically 1‑2 % of your bankroll. This steadies variance and lets you experience the multiplier feature without risking large swings.
  • Progressive betting – increase your stake after a loss or after a non‑multiplier win. Use cautiously; it can amplify losses if a streak of plain spins occurs.

Focusing on single‑number bets maximises the impact of any Lightning multiplier because the 35:1 base payout is already high. Pair this with occasional outside bets (red/black, even/odd) to create a safety net that cushions the bankroll while you chase the big numbers.

The “Inside‑Out” approach blends the two ideas: place a modest straight‑up bet on a chosen number and simultaneously cover a column or dozen. If the straight‑up hit lands on a multiplier, you reap a massive win; if not, the column bet returns a smaller, but consistent, profit.

Safety, Fairness, and Licensing in Live Roulette

Reputable operators must hold licences from respected regulators such as the Malta Gaming Authority (MGA) or the United Kingdom Gambling Commission (UKGC). These bodies audit both the live‑dealer studio and the RNG that selects Lightning multipliers, ensuring that outcomes are random and not subject to manipulation. Independent testing firms like iTech Labs or GLI certify the software, providing players with a transparent audit trail.

Data encryption (SSL/TLS 256‑bit) protects all financial transactions and personal information, while firewalls and intrusion‑detection systems guard against cyber threats. When a casino advertises “fast payouts,” it typically means withdrawals are processed within 24‑48 hours, a claim that can be verified through user reviews on sites like Destinationlebanon, which aggregates player experiences without endorsing any specific operator.

Verifying a Casino’s License

  1. Locate the licence number on the casino’s footer or “About Us” page.
  2. Visit the regulator’s official website (e.g., MGA, UKGC) and enter the number in the verification tool.
  3. Confirm that the licence is active, covers live‑dealer games, and matches the jurisdiction you reside in.

Responsible Gaming Tools

Most licensed platforms provide self‑exclusion options, daily or monthly deposit limits, and session timers. These tools help players keep wagering within comfortable bounds and prevent problem gambling. Look for a dedicated “Responsible Gaming” hub on the casino’s site; reputable operators will also display links to external support organisations such as GamCare or the National Council on Problem Gambling.
